Crisp, refreshing, and completely dairy-free, this Lettuce and Cucumber Salad is the perfect side dish for any meal or a light, healthy lunch all on its own. Packed with fresh ingredients like crunchy romaine lettuce, juicy cherry tomatoes, hydrating cucumber, and zesty red onion, this vibrant salad is a celebration of clean eating. Chopped fresh parsley adds an herby brightness, while a simple dressing made with extra virgin olive oil and tangy lemon juice ties everything together beautifully. Best of all, this no-cook recipe comes together in just 15 minutes, making it a go-to for busy weeknights or last-minute gatherings. Wash and dry the romaine lettuce. Tear the leaves into bite-size pieces and place them in a large salad bowl.
Peel and slice the cucumber into thin rounds and add to the bowl with the lettuce.
Halve the cherry tomatoes and add them to the bowl.
Thinly slice the red onion and add it to the bowl.
Chop the fresh parsley and sprinkle it over the salad.
In a small bowl, whisk together the extra virgin ol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per to create the dressing.
Pour the dressing over the salad and toss gently to combine and evenly distribute the ingredients.
Serve immediately to enjoy the fresh and crisp flavors.
